    2: # Contributor Covenant Code of Conduct
    3: 
    4: ## Our Pledge
    5: 
    6: We as members, contributors, and leaders pledge to make participation in our
    7: community a harassment-free experience for everyone, regardless of age, body
    8: size, visible or invisible disability, ethnicity, sex characteristics, gender
    9: identity and expression, level of experience, education, socio-economic status,
   10: nationality, personal appearance, race, caste, color, religion, or sexual
   11: identity and orientation.
   12: 
   13: We pledge to act and interact in ways that contribute to an open, welcoming,
   14: diverse, inclusive, and healthy community.
   15: 
   16: ## Our Standards
   17: 
   18: Examples of behavior that contributes to a positive environment for our
   19: community include:
   20: 
   21: * Demonstrating empathy and kindness toward other people
   22: * Being respectful of differing opinions, viewpoints, and experiences
   23: * Giving and gracefully accepting constructive feedback
   24: * Accepting responsibility and apologizing to those affected by our mistakes,
   25:   and learning from the experience
   26: * Focusing on what is best not just for us as individuals, but for the overall
   27:   community
   28: 
   29: Examples of unacceptable behavior include:
   30: 
   31: * The use of sexualized language or imagery, and sexual attention or advances of
   32:   any kind
   33: * Trolling, insulting or derogatory comments, and personal or political attacks
   34: * Public or private harassment
   35: * Publishing others' private information, such as a physical or email address,
   36:   without their explicit permission
   37: * Other conduct which could reasonably be considered inappropriate in a
   38:   professional setting
   39: 
   40: ## Enforcement Responsibilities
   41: 
   42: Community leaders are responsible for clarifying and enforcing our standards of
   43: acceptable behavior and will take appropriate and fair corrective action in
   44: response to any behavior that they deem inappropriate, threatening, offensive,
   45: or harmful.
   46: 
   47: Community leaders have the right and responsibility to remove, edit, or reject
   48: comments, commits, code, wiki edits, issues, and other contributions that are
   49: not aligned to this Code of Conduct, and will communicate reasons for moderation
   50: decisions when appropriate.
   51: 
   52: ## Scope
   53: 
   54: This Code of Conduct applies within all community spaces, and also applies when
   55: an individual is officially representing the community in public spaces.
   56: Examples of representing our community include using an official e-mail address,
   57: posting via an official social media account, or acting as an appointed
   58: representative at an online or offline event.
   59: 
   60: ## Enforcement
   61: 
   62: Instances of abusive, harassing, or otherwise unacceptable behavior may be
   63: reported to the community leaders responsible for enforcement at
   64: freem-coc@coherent-logic.com.
   65: 
   66: All complaints will be reviewed and investigated promptly and fairly.
   67: 
   68: All community leaders are obligated to respect the privacy and security of the
   69: reporter of any incident.
   70: 
   71: ## Enforcement Guidelines
   72: 
   73: Community leaders will follow these Community Impact Guidelines in determining
   74: the consequences for any action they deem in violation of this Code of Conduct:
   75: 
   76: ### 1. Correction
   77: 
   78: **Community Impact**: Use of inappropriate language or other behavior deemed
   79: unprofessional or unwelcome in the community.
   80: 
   81: **Consequence**: A private, written warning from community leaders, providing
   82: clarity around the nature of the violation and an explanation of why the
   83: behavior was inappropriate. A public apology may be requested.
   84: 
   85: ### 2. Warning
   86: 
   87: **Community Impact**: A violation through a single incident or series of
   88: actions.
   89: 
   90: **Consequence**: A warning with consequences for continued behavior. No
   91: interaction with the people involved, including unsolicited interaction with
   92: those enforcing the Code of Conduct, for a specified period of time. This
   93: includes avoiding interactions in community spaces as well as external channels
   94: like social media. Violating these terms may lead to a temporary or permanent
   95: ban.
   96: 
   97: ### 3. Temporary Ban
   98: 
   99: **Community Impact**: A serious violation of community standards, including
  100: sustained inappropriate behavior.
  101: 
  102: **Consequence**: A temporary ban from any sort of interaction or public
  103: communication with the community for a specified period of time. No public or
  104: private interaction with the people involved, including unsolicited interaction
  105: with those enforcing the Code of Conduct, is allowed during this period.
  106: Violating these terms may lead to a permanent ban.
  107: 
  108: ### 4. Permanent Ban
  109: 
  110: **Community Impact**: Demonstrating a pattern of violation of community
  111: standards, including sustained inappropriate behavior, harassment of an
  112: individual, or aggression toward or disparagement of classes of individuals.
  113: 
  114: **Consequence**: A permanent ban from any sort of public interaction within the
  115: community.
  116:
